How was GTN discovered?

Nitroglycerine (NG) was discovered in 1847 by Ascanio Sobrero in Turin, following work with Theophile-Jules Pelouze. Sobrero first noted the ‘violent headache’ produced by minute quantities of NG on the tongue. 2.

How do I take the GTN?

Take GTN tablet immediately if you experience chest pain (refer to the picture below). To prevent an attack, take five minutes before you exercise, having sexual activity or prior exposure to cold. Hot and tingling sensation under your tongue while taking this medicine proves that it is still effective.

How does GTN work in MI?

Nitroglycerin remains a first-line treatment for angina pectoris and acute myocardial infarction. Nitroglycerin achieves its benefit by giving rise to nitric oxide, which causes vasodilation and increases blood flow to the myocardium.

What type of drug is GTN?

About glyceryl trinitrate for angina

Type of medicine A nitrate
Used for Chest pain associated with angina
Also called Nitroglycerin (in US); GTN; Coro-Nitro®; Deponit®; Glytrin®; Minitran®; Nitrolingual®; Transiderm-Nitro®
Available as Spray, sublingual tablets (for under the tongue), ointment and patches

What class of drug is GTN?

Glyceryl trinitrate (GTN) belongs to a class of medications called Nitrates. Nitrates are used to prevent and treat the symptoms of angina (chest pain). Angina is caused by lack of blood supply and oxygen to your heart. Nitrates work by relaxing blood vessels so that more blood and oxygen is supplied to the heart.

Does angina shorten your life?

It’s not usually life threatening, but it’s a warning sign that you could be at risk of a heart attack or stroke. With treatment and healthy lifestyle changes, it’s possible to control angina and reduce the risk of these more serious problems.
